🔥The RWA market grew from $6.6B to $26.4B in one year. But most projects are still losing institutional investors before the first conversation.
65% of tokenized asset holders are institutional. They analyze yield, compliance, and who else is already in the room. 😎😎
What doesn't work: Crypto jargon. Discord communities. Influencer campaigns. "Revolutionary protocol" messaging.
What does:
🎯 Yield-first content — lead with numbers, not narrative
🎯 Compliance as a marketing asset — audits, regulatory alignment, real case studies
🎯 Right channels — Financial Times, offline briefings, financial analysts
🎯 Live dashboards with real-time data — they convert better than any ad copy

3. How do you distinguish a promising project? 🎯
For me, it always starts with one core question: what real problem does the project solve?
Is it a startup built around hype and a quick TGE to raise capital? Or is it addressing a genuine user pain point beyond crypto Twitter? That’s my first and most important filter.
The second filter is founder vision. If the goal is simply to “raise a million” without a clear long-term roadmap, defined audience, and sustainable KPIs, that’s a red flag. I want to see long-term thinking, not short-term extraction.
The third factor is the founders themselves. I look at their background, proactivity, willingness to take responsibility, invest their own resources, build networks, and think strategically.
A strong project is never just about technology. It’s about real value, mature vision, and founders who are ready to build for years, not for one cycle.

2. What about MiCA and regulation? How has it affected business development? 🏦
Regulation has clearly reshaped the market, especially in Europe. Due diligence requirements increased. Legal structures became more important. Deal cycles got longer. Projects now allocate more resources to legal support and compliance, which raises costs.
At the same time, there is a positive side. Institutional trust has grown. Capital increasingly flows to projects solving real problems instead of short-term meme narratives. Regulation also filters out one-day teams.
However, we see part of Web3 activity shifting toward Asia. Some projects prefer relocating operations rather than fully adapting to MiCA. As a result, Asia currently looks more dynamic, while Europe is moving at a slower pace.
